Limerick artist Post Punk Podge & The Technohippies has teamed up with Dundalk’s finest TPM for a song about toxic masculinity.

“There’s no hard men in Dublin, everyone knows that, ” say TPM.


Some hard men like to wear hats, they always like dogs, they never like cats.”

“You’re only hard when your friends are around!”.

Just a few choice lines from this fun and useful tune.

It’s out tomorrow officially via Bandcamp with a B side called ‘Haunted By History’ feat. Maria Larkin.


Video directed by Graham Patterson.
Produced & mixed by Michéal Keating.
